University program administrator
Ives, Nancy Reynolds was born on April 19, 1939 in Syracuse, New York, United States. Daughter of Paul Fred and Muriel (Plant) Reynolds.
Bachelor of Education, State University of New York, Oswego, 1973; Master of Arts in English, State University of New York, Oswego, 1977.
Adjunct instructor English, Onondaga Community College, Syracuse, 1976-1977; lecturer writing, State University of New York, Geneseo, 1977-1981; assistant director/academic coordinator access opportunity programs, State University of New York, Geneseo, since 1991.
Member New York College Learning Skills Association (political liaison 1993-1996, editorial board member Research and Technology Development Education since 1996), National Teachers English, United University Professions (delegate assembly since 1992, membership chair since 1992, Professional Study award 1995, vice president for professionals since 1996).
Married Brian Douglas Ives, 1957 (divorced 1984). Married Edwin H. Wheeler, May 28, 1988. Children: Janet Marilyn, Michael Jon.
